We present the results of multiwavelength study of NGC 4068 dwarf galaxy based on scanning Fabry-Perot interferometry observations in the H-alpha emission line made with the SAO RAS 6-m telescope together with other spectral and archival imaging observations including HST and GALEX data. The analysis of HI kinematics of this nearby dwarf galaxy gave us evidence of the tidal perturbation in the outer part of the gaseous disk. It is possible that NGC 4068 recently experienced a minor-merging event. Optical and UV images of NGC 4068 reveal a number of bright complexes of ongoing star formation with sizes up to several hundreds of kpc as well as kpc-sized shell- like structures seen in H-alpha emission line. It is known that the last star formation burst in this galaxy started about 400 Myr ago, but high star formation rate is still persists. The comparison of energy distribution in optical and UV range allowed us to find the signs of triggering star formation occurring in the most of star formation complexes. The metallicity and the energy budget of each of the star formation regions were analysed.
